Britney Spears was born in Kentwood, Louisiana on December 2, 1981. Appearing in variety shows and choirs throughout her hometown, Britney’s talent was obvious from a young age. The aspiring young performer’s first major audition was for The Disney Channel’s “Mickey Mouse Club” at the age of eight. Amazon.co.uk Review

Featuring a flurry of musical moods from a variety of producers--everyone from The Outsyders and Lil to Rodney "Darkchild" Jerkins and Lady Gaga--Britney's new album, Circus is clearly a determined effort to haul herself back to the top of the pops after a particularly rocky year. Lead single “Womanizer", with its stuttering drumbeat, buzzing synths and hooky chorus, is reminiscent of the album's other sonic firework, the raunchy “If U Seek Amy". These fiery missives indicate that Britney is back on form--but many other songs come across as damp squibs in comparison. Her extensive use of Auto-Tune adds a robotic aspect to her voice, rendering certain songs less engaging than they could be (the 80s electro of “Leather & Lace" and the title track are two examples). Opener “Mannequin", the ballad “Out from Under" and “Kill the Lights" (a song about the paparazzi) come close to previous form, but still lack the essential spark needed to make Circus the album it could --and should--have been. --Danny McKenna

BRITNEY SPEARS Circus (2008 UK Deluxe Edition 2-disc set - Britneys 6th studio album which sees her reunite with previous collaborators such as Max Martin Danja and Bloodshy & Avant. This 2-disc edition of Circus comprises a 16-trackCD album featuring the singles Womanizer Circus If U Seek Amy and the 4 Bonus Recordings Radar Rock Me In Phonography & Amnesia; plus a Bonus Region 0 NTSC DVD including making-of the album footage with an exclusive interview the directors cut video of Womanizer and a photo gallery!)

It didn't happen overnight, but Britney is back to the one woman pop machine she used to be. While 'Blackout' was a great album it got lost along the way during all the drama, but it's here, album number 6, and what an album it has turned out to be. The albums sound seems to be an equal mix of Blackout and the Britney of years ago. It's not quite as electronic as Blackout and brings back more of Britney's personality in to the album. This is the first album since 2001's 'Britney' that she has collaborated with Max Martin, also Danja is back producing along with Bloodshy & Avant. New producers (The Outsyders & The Underdogs)have been brought in too to make sure the album isn't too predictable. The only slight let down is (surprisingly) the Bloodshy & Avant production. 'Unusual You' is just not up to their previous work together, its not bad just a bit bland next to the other tracks.
This album is every bit as solid as Blackout was, whilst not every song is amazing, none are at all bad. Lead single 'Womanizer' is certainatly a great song, catchy, fast and not too deep, but that's just for starters. It is definately not the best song on the album. Next single lined up is Dr Luke produced 'Circus' which is 100 times better again than Womanizer. It moves at a slower pace but the beat is heavier & the songs feel overall is darker. Pure brilliance!! Other great tracks include 'If You Seek Amy' which is a really catchy song (helped along by the play on words (",)). One thing that Blackout was missing was a genuinely emotional ballad and Circus serves up a great one 'Out From Under' which discusses finding your feet after the breakdown of a relationship. A really genuine song from Britney. 'Lace & Leather' and Danja produced 'Kill The Lights' are yet more great tracks from the set. 'Kill The Lights' runs the same track as Piece of Me - an anti-paparazzi track which although not as catchy, is definately better written than 'Piece Of Me', 'Lace & Leather' delves into something a little raunchier. Despite all these great tracks, there is one which stands head and shoulders above the rest, and that is 'Mannequin'. Produced by The Underdogs this song is fueled by a thumping bassline, swirls of synthesisers and so much energy the speakers nearly melt. Yurn this track up and feel the hairs on the back of yor neck stand on end!! A brilliant song brimming with energy. One of the best she has done.
Overall, this a great great geat album, a total return to form for Britney taking her current sound forward whilst reincorporating the good bits of the old Britney back in again. With several bonus tracks about too such as 'Rock Me In' 'Phonography' 'Trouble' and 'Amnesia' (depending on what edition you get) there is plently of new Britney to enjoy. This is the last step in achieving the full comeback. Fantastic.

Blackout-Lite. 1 Dec 2008
Format:Audio CD
So, one of the most highly anticipated albums of the year is finally here, but how does it measure up? Womanizer is a fabulous song, perfect pop, but when I first heard it, it just didn't jump out at me like Gimme More did last year. The case with the tracks' respective albums is the same. I was blown away by Blackout, it exceeded all my expectations with it's filthy, edgy, electro feel and banging beats. However, Circus is none of the above. I feel Britney and her team have taken a much safer approach to this album, whereas they threw caution to the wind on Blackout. The album is much more approachable than Blackout, and it seems that they are trying to stick in mainstream pop and appeal to as many people as possible. The songs are still catchy,a prime example being the title track. However, they often don't live up to their raunchy titles such as Lace and leather, a good song, but again I feel they're playing it safe.

Overall, this album is good, but lacks the edge that would have made it great. However, I would still recommend this to a wide audience of all ages.
